While crypto markets wobbled through February’s volatility, Ripple revealed a series of heavyweight partnerships and feature rollouts that could reshape the XRPL ecosystem for years to come. The standout announcement? Aviva Investors joining forces with Ripple on February 11, 2026, marking the first European investment management business to tokenize traditional fund structures on the XRP Ledger. Not just another press release. This is the real deal.

Ripple’s strategic Aviva partnership isn’t just noise—it’s institutional validation for XRPL’s tokenization future.

The February ledger update introduces permissioned DEXs scheduled for Q2 2026 and a native lending protocol rolling out in Q1. These aren’t minor tweaks—they’re addressing a massive gap in on-chain yield for XRP holders. About time, right?

Meanwhile, the Zand Bank partnership is already live, creating a bridge between AEDZ stablecoin and RLUSD on XRPL. Ripple has successfully removed key barriers for banks on the XRP Ledger, potentially unlocking billions in institutional flows. XRP’s price hasn’t exactly matched the excitement. After hitting $2.40, it retraced to the $1.50 range. But aggressive buy-backs at the $1.43-$1.45 level suggest smart money sees value. Break above the 100-day EMA at $2.22, and we’re looking at $2.35-$2.80 territory.

Behind closed doors, Wall Street giants are paying attention. BlackRock, Mastercard, and Franklin Templeton are actively evaluating XRPL technology. They’re not doing this for fun. The pressure’s on banks to upgrade their prehistoric cross-border payment systems, and XRPL’s 4 billion processed transactions since 2012 speak volumes.

Performance metrics show recent payment volumes hitting 1.88 million, maintained by 120 independent validators. No mining required. Energy efficiency matters these days.

The White House forecasts mainstream tokenization in 1-3 years, perfectly timed with the Clarity Act reducing legal risk for XRP in 2026. The update introduces powerful Multi-Purpose Tokens designed specifically for real-world asset tokenization that financial institutions have been demanding. The network now supports 7 million active wallets—a number that will seem quaint in retrospect.
